150 tph pebble crushing production line in Vietnam
A 150 tph pebble crushing production line in Vietnam is a project that involves crushing and processing pebbles, which are small to medium-sized round stones, often used as decorative landscaping stones or for construction purposes. The 150 tph (tons per hour) indicates the production capacity of the crushing plant.

Here’s a general outline of what such a production line might involve:
- Raw Material Acquisition: The project starts with acquiring the pebbles from local sources or quarries.
- Feeding: The pebbles are transported from the source to the primary crusher through trucks, conveyors, or other means.
- Primary Crushing: The primary crusher, like a jaw crusher or a gyratory crusher, breaks the pebbles into smaller pieces. The exact configuration may vary based on the specific requirements of the project.
- Secondary Crushing: After the primary crushing stage, the smaller pebble pieces may undergo further crushing in a secondary crusher to achieve the desired size and shape.
- Screening and Grading: The crushed pebbles are then screened to separate different sizes. The screened materials are sorted into various grades based on their sizes.
- Conveying and Storage: The graded pebbles are transported to storage bins or stockpiles through conveyor belts for easy handling and future use.
- Sand Making (optional): In some cases, the project might require the production of artificial sand from pebbles. This can be achieved through processes like VSI (Vertical Shaft Impact) crushing or sand-making machines.
- Washing (optional): Depending on the project requirements, a washing process might be employed to remove impurities and improve the quality of the final product.
- Final Product: The final product of the crushing production line could be a mixture of different sizes of pebbles or specific grades based on the project’s needs.
- Environmental Considerations: Throughout the project, environmental factors and regulations need to be taken into account to ensure sustainable practices are followed.
It’s important to note that the actual configuration of the crushing production line may vary depending on factors such as the specific properties of the pebbles, the geological conditions of the site, the availability of equipment, and the client’s requirements.
